Linux-day1

本文介绍了Linux的一些基本操作指令,包括改变目录的`cd`,查看目录内容的`ls`,文件复制的`cp`,文件移动及重命名的`mv`,删除文件和目录的`rm`,创建目录的`mkdir`,创建新文件的`touch`以及查看文件内容的`cat`和编辑文件的`vim`。
摘要由CSDN通过智能技术生成

Linux操作指令-day1

一、日常操作
1、cd指令 -打开文件夹
cd ..	-进入上级目录
cd /	-进入操作系统根目录
cd ~	-进入电脑的文件系统根目录
2、ls指令 -显示当前目录中含有的内容
ls		-直接显示当前文件夹中的内容(隐藏的文件以及文件夹看不到)
ls -a	-也是显示当前文件夹所含有大的内容,包括隐藏文件。
ls -R 	-递归显示当前目录以及目录下所有子目录的内容
ls -r	-内容倒序显示
ls -S/-t  -显示文件夹内容,并按内容大小、实践从大到小排列
ls -Sr  -按大小从小到大排序
ls -Srlh  -按大小从大到小排列,并且显示基本信息
3、cp指令 -复制拷贝
cp 文件夹路径1 文件夹路径2  
# 将文件路径1指定的文件中的内容,复制到文件路径2指定的文件中,2中对应的文件本身不存在
cp b.txt  c.txt		-c.txt本身不存在,复制后,c会有b中的内容
cp 文件 文件复制到的路径		-将指定文件复制粘贴到指定文件加中
cp b.txt ../hudinge/		-将b复制到上级目录的hudinge文件夹中
cp -r 文件夹路径1   文件夹路径2 	-将文件夹1的内容复制到文件夹2中
cp -r files3/ study/   将files3文件夹的内容复制到study中
4、mv指令 -移动文件、文件夹、重命名文件夹
mv 文件名1 文件名2	-对文件进行重命名操作,将1的名字改为文件名2
mv  a.txt  b.txt	-将当前文件夹中的a.txt重命名为b.txt
mv  /home/a.txt  /home/b.txt	-将系统根目录下home文件中的a.txt重命名

5、rm指令 -删除文件、文件夹
rm 文件路径 -删除指定文件(删除的时候会询问是否确定删除,y为同意;n为不同意)
rm -f 文件路径		-强制删除,不询问
rm -i 文件路径		-删除指定文件,同样询问
rm -r 文件夹路径		-删除指定文件夹
rmdir 文件夹路径 	-删除空目录,这个文件夹必须是空的
# 注意指令可以合写,如: rm - rf 文件夹路径 强制删除此文件夹
6、mkdir指令 -创建文件夹
mkdir  文件夹名		-在当前目录创建文件夹
mkdir -p 文件夹名		-a、b、c三个文件夹可以在之前未创建过,p会使mkdir在当前目录中创建a文件夹,在a中创建b,b中创建c
mkdir -p a/{b,c}	-{}中创建的是同级文件夹,a、b、c可以都没有,当前目录创建a,a中创建b和c

7、touch指令 -创建新文件
touch 文件路径/文件名 		-在指定位置创建指定文件
touch a.txt			-在当前目录下新建一个文件a.txt
touch ../a.txt		-在当前目录的上级目录中新建一个a.txt文件
touch /home/a/a.txt   -在根目录下的home目录中的a目录中创建也有一个文件a.txt
8、cat指令 -查看文件内容
cat 文件路径		-堵路指定路径对应的文件内容
vim 文件路径		-打开vim编辑器
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值